Additive manufacturing technological innovation very first emerged in the eighties and was utilized to print plastic objects with a way often called Stereolithography (SLA). In SLA an ultraviolet gentle beam is accustomed to selectively cure a photosensitive polymer to make up a component layer by layer. Later on other procedures for printing plastic objects emerged for example Fused Deposition Modeling (FDM). In FDM a thermoplastic filament is extruded from a nozzle and heated to build up an object layer by layer.Laser-based additive manufacturing is another technique used to print metallic objects.

In The usa, the FAA has expected a want to use additive manufacturing procedures and has actually been thinking about how ideal to control this method.[136] The FAA has jurisdiction about this kind of fabrication simply because all aircraft pieces need to be manufactured beneath FAA manufacturing acceptance or underneath other FAA regulatory classes.[137] In December 2016, the FAA permitted the manufacture of a 3D printed gas nozzle for your GE LEAP motor.

The layered framework of all Additive Manufacturing processes sales opportunities inevitably to the strain-stepping effect on part surfaces which might be curved or tilted in respect to your making System. The results strongly rely on the orientation of an element surface area Within the setting up method.[forty one]
